Property Overview: 323 Abbotsfield Drive, Winnipeg
Key Characteristics & Appeal
This bi-level home at 323 Abbotsfield Drive in Dakota Crossing presents a practical and modern living opportunity. Its key characteristic is its relative newness; built in 2003, it is significantly newer than most homes in its immediate area, city-wide, and even within its own neighbourhood. This suggests updated building systems and less immediate need for major repairs compared to older stock. The home features a renovated basement and an attached garage, with a living space of 1,249 sqft on a standard 4,882 sqft lot.
